Transparency of the KOA Camp grounds in Dickinson, N.D.. In the front of the picture is the Heart River. Large trees provide shade for picnic tables, RVs, trailers, station wagons, cars, and pickups. In the middle of the photo, behind the trees and vehicles, is the KOA headquarters building, painted red. To the right of the building is a large propane tank. Behind this tank is a telephone/electric pole. color. Unidentified.
